The Advantages Of BANT Appointment Setting

In the fast-paced world of sales, one of the most crucial components is setting appointments with potential customers This is where BANT appointment setting can make a significant difference BANT is an acronym that stands for Budget, Authority, Need, and Timeline By focusing on these four key elements, sales professionals can qualify leads more effectively and ensure that their time is spent on prospects that are more likely to convert In this article, we will discuss the advantages of BANT appointment setting and how it can help drive sales success.

One of the primary benefits of BANT appointment setting is that it helps sales professionals prioritize their leads By understanding the prospect’s budget, authority, need, and timeline, sales reps can quickly determine whether a potential customer is worth pursuing For example, if a prospect does not have the budget or authority to make a purchasing decision, it may not be worth investing time in scheduling an appointment By qualifying leads based on BANT criteria, sales reps can focus their efforts on prospects that are more likely to result in a sale.

Another advantage of BANT appointment setting is that it helps sales reps gather valuable information about the prospect’s needs and timeline By asking targeted questions related to the prospect’s requirements and desired timeline for making a purchase, sales professionals can better understand how their product or service can meet the prospect’s needs This information can then be used to tailor the sales pitch and offerings to better align with the prospect’s requirements, increasing the likelihood of a successful sale.
